Excerpt6 - Point’d Preachin’ My pastor’s getting out of hand,
He asked me did I understand
That soon all men from every land
Before a holy God will stand.
He said, "Then you may tell the Lord
Why He should give you some reward."

But surely angels will remember,
I bought a chalice last September.
It was pure gold, that lovely chalice,
With money left by old Aunt Alice.
Can all my works be burned to cinders?
I also bought two stained-glass windows.

Don’t pass my deeds up in a hurry,
They’re spoken of through Wintonbury.
There’s Jenny Jones and her old Sammy-
I paid their two weeks in Miami.
I’ve done a host of wondrous things-
Besides, we’re not all rich as kings!

My pastor called my life a libel,
And said it was not like the Bible.
I can’t read long (I need new glasses),
And get confused about Saul’s asses-
And sure that story seems a boner
About a whale swallowed by Jonah.
I like religion hale and hearty-
A miss’n’ry film and ice cream party,
And pictures of the pyramids-
But we don’t need those noisy kids,
They bring the worst side out of me,
Leave them at home-they have T.V.!
I pay my tithes and fill my pew-
Surely there’s nothing else to do!
